SOME PIGEONS ARE MORE EQUEL THAN OTHERS, is a project by Berlin-based artists Julian Charriere and Julius von Bismarck during the 2012 Venice Biennale.
Most people see city pigeons as a pest, or … as “rats of the sky”
In an effort to make people see these feathered critters in a different way Charriere and Bismarck spray-painted them by way of a specially created booth.
The artists believed that people would see the pigeons in these exotic colors as less offensive, and in turn, more accepted by those traveling the Venetian piazzas.
